Responsibilities- In charge of looking after day-to-day operations
- Quick response to driver's problems i.e., customers refusing stock, truck breakdowns etc.
- Liaising with planners to add loads.
- Manage drivers working hours as well as rate my delivery KPIs by calling drivers and customers.
- Compiling distribution reports required for DPO (Distribution Optimization Process)
- Attending mandatory meetings with drivers.
- Conducting trade visits to check on customers and drivers.
Skills- Knowledge of customer service principles.
- Demonstrates reliability.
- Good interpersonal skills / builds good relationships.
- Ability to work under pressure.
- Verbal ability and communication skills
- Excellent self-management and planning skills
- Strong achievement orientation.
Minimum Requirements- 3-year Tertiary Degree / Diploma, preferably in supply chain and or logistics.
- 2 years experience in a customer service role within an FMCG Supply chain and or logistics.
- Valid code 8 drivers licence.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office.
- SAP experience will be preferred.
